Home Office-Hilfe.com - Wir lösen Ihr Problem mit Microsoft Excel, Word, Outlook, PowerPoint, Access gratis Forum Impressum

 [Excel 2003] externe Tabelle bzw. deren Namen in Funktion einfügen
Neues Thema eröffnenNeue Antwort erstellen
Autor Nachricht
TheRedNoseRudolf
Newbie
Newbie


Anmeldedatum: 11.04.2008
Beiträge: 8

BeitragVerfasst am: 14.04.2008, 16:09 Nach oben

Hallo,

ich habe Folgendes Problem: Ich habe ein Excel-Sheet, dass aus unterschiedlichen Dateien Werte einsammeln und verarbeiten soll. Dazu habe ich den nachstehenden Aufruf gestaltet:

=SVERWEIS(Q32;'[Dateiname.xls]Blattname'!$A$9:$BM$63;$R$29;FALSCH)

Klappt alles wunderbar Smile Diese Funktion zeigt einen Wert aus der Datei an! Da es aber nicht nur diese eine Formel, sondern eine Vielzahl von Funktionsaufrufen gibt, möchte ich in ein Feld (Q22) den Namen der Datei (ohne .xls), in ein weiteres Feld (Q23) den Namen des Tabellenblatts eingeben. Die jeweiligen Funktionen sollen dann auf diese Felder zugreifen und die Namen einfügen.

Das habe ich folgendermaßen probiert:

=SVERWEIS(Q32;(INDIREKT("'["&Q22&".xls]"&Q23&"'!"))&$A$9:$BM$63;$R$29;FALSCH)

Das Problem scheint hier zu sein, dass er zwar den Namen der Datei irgendwie einliest und anerkennt, aber in keinster Weise berücksichtigt, denn der Wert, den die Funktion ausgibt, befindet sich in der Datei, von der die Funktion aufgerufen wird, nicht aber in der externen.

Was habe ich wohl falsch gemacht bzw. was ich kann ich alternativ nutzen?

Gruß und vielen Dank, TheRedNoseRudolf
Benutzer-Profile anzeigenPrivate Nachricht senden
schatzi
Moderator
Moderator


Anmeldedatum: 09.12.2006
Beiträge: 4842

BeitragVerfasst am: 14.04.2008, 16:25 Nach oben

Hallo!

Solange diese externe Datei GEÖFFNET ist, müsste dein Konstrukt eigentlich funktionieren.
Allerdings kann INDIREKT nicht mit GESCHLOSSENEN Dateien umgehen.
Es gibt aber ein AddIn, das das kann:
Google mal nach "INDIRECT.EXT".

PS: Korrektur:
So funktioniert die Formel doch nicht...
Wenn die Datei geöffnet ist, dann sollte aber dies klappen:

=SVERWEIS(Q32;INDIREKT("'["&Q22&".xls]"&Q23&"'!A9:BM63");$R$29;0)

_________________

Viele Grüße vom Schatzi

------------------------
Dies ist meine Signatur und sie trägt eigentlich nichts zur Lösung deines Problems bei. Sollte sie es dennoch tun, dann bist du definitiv im falschen Forum...Image
Ein Feedback zum ursprünglichen Problem wäre trotzdem nett!
Windows XP, Office2000, Office2007
Benutzer-Profile anzeigenPrivate Nachricht senden
TheRedNoseRudolf
Newbie
Newbie


Anmeldedatum: 11.04.2008
Beiträge: 8

BeitragVerfasst am: 14.04.2008, 16:28 Nach oben

Perfekt, danke für die superschnelle Antwort!
Benutzer-Profile anzeigenPrivate Nachricht senden
Beiträge der letzten Zeit anzeigen:      
Neues Thema eröffnenNeue Antwort erstellen


Ähnliche Beiträge
Thema Autor Forum Antworten Verfasst am
Keine neuen Beiträge [2003] Einfügen von Tabellenwerten au... ninjaracer Microsoft Excel Hilfe 1 04.07.2008, 11:18 Letzten Beitrag anzeigen
Keine neuen Beiträge Zellenschattierung mit wenn funktion... yetie Microsoft Excel Hilfe 2 01.07.2008, 15:19 Letzten Beitrag anzeigen
Keine neuen Beiträge fehlende Werte in Tabelle automatisch... mm211 Microsoft Excel Hilfe 4 30.06.2008, 13:34 Letzten Beitrag anzeigen
Keine neuen Beiträge ODER-Funktion msdd79 Microsoft Excel Hilfe 2 28.06.2008, 20:52 Letzten Beitrag anzeigen
Keine neuen Beiträge Erweiterung der heute funktion goldfinger32 Microsoft Excel Hilfe 4 26.06.2008, 09:14 Letzten Beitrag anzeigen


 Gehe zu:   



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.
Du kannst Dateien in diesem Forum posten
Du kannst Dateien in diesem Forum herunterladen

Haftungsausschluss/Disclaimer


SMS kostenlos versenden | Battle-Dream | Tuning Forum | Join the YoungGeneration | krankenversicherungsvergleich | Kalorienarme Rezepte!
Versicherungsvergleich | Bürobedarf | Papier | Betten

Ranking-Hits



Powered by phpBB © 2001, 2002 phpBB Group :: FI Theme :: Alle Zeiten sind GMT + 1 Stunde
Deutsche Übersetzung von phpBB.de